7554 is a first-person shooter that takes players back in time to the climactic final stages of the first Indochina War. Set in Vietnam, the game delves into the historical struggle between the Vietnam People's Army revolutionaries and the French oppressors. This unique setting immediately evokes a sense of nostalgia for those who are familiar with classic war games from the past.
The single-player campaign of 7554 thrusts gamers onto the frontlines of a colonial independence movement, where they find themselves pitted against a technologically superior Western occupier. The game successfully captures the intensity and challenges faced by the revolutionaries as they fight for their freedom in a hostile environment.

However, despite these nostalgic elements, 7554 falls short in several areas. The game's controls and mechanics can often feel clunky and unresponsive, hindering the overall enjoyment. The AI of both friendly and enemy soldiers also leaves much to be desired, with occasional moments of frustration as they fail to react realistically to the player's actions.
Furthermore, the lackluster level design and repetitive mission structure diminish the overall experience. The game struggles to keep players engaged and invested in the story due to its linear nature and lack of innovation. As a result, the gameplay can become monotonous, making it difficult to fully immerse oneself in the historical narrative.
